About us

Riverlane’s mission is to make quantum computing useful sooner. To achieve this, Riverlane is building the Quantum Error Correction Stack to comprehensively correct the millions of data errors that prevent today’s quantum computers from achieving useful scale.

    🤔 Did you know qubits have a ‘soft side’?   With our collaborators at Delft University of Technology, we demonstrated the positive impact of using all the data (both hard and soft) coming from a qubit to enhance quantum error correction.   🔟 Typically, quantum decoders rely only on ‘hard’ digitised measurement outcomes – 0s and 1s – and ignore the valuable information embedded in the analogue ‘soft’ measurement signal.   📈This information provides insight into the likelihood of a measurement error having occurred and thus can be used by the quantum decoder to improve its performance.    🤝Using Delft’s 17-qubit superconducting quantum computer, we saw an improvement in the extracted logical error rate, a measure of the error correction performance, with the use of soft information.     💥 While this improvement is limited at the moment, as quantum computers scale then the benefits of using soft information will become more pronounced, especially as we move from memory experiments to logical operations.   Check out the paper, now available in Physical Review Applied: https://lnkd.in/ey2UC4Mu And a previous blog post from the team also explains the implications of this paper for QEC: https://lnkd.in/ehQ_akxz   #quantumcomputing | #quantumerrorcorrection

    ⚪️ Different qubit types have different strengths and weaknesses. Some have fast response times but operate at near 0K temperatures. Others have unmatched stability and high gate fidelities but long gate operation times, and some have limited connectivity.    📈 One universal factor is that every qubit type has increased in number and improved on error rates over the last two decades, approaching a ‘practical QEC threshold’ of around 99.9% fidelity (i.e. an error rate of 10^-3) for two-qubit gates. ‘The system size and gate fidelities are just now crossing the threshold required for error correction... the interesting phase for quantum computing is just starting.’ – Jan Goetz, co-CEO and co-Founder at IQM Quantum Computers.  You can find out more about 'the three nines' and recent progress towards useful quantum computing by signing up to receive The Quantum Error Correction Report 2024: https://lnkd.in/eDMutzbB  ( 🔜 Due for release in late October!)   #quantumcomputing | #QEC | #quantumerrorcorrection | #TheQECReport2024

    Quantum error correction (QEC) is essential to achieving the accuracy needed for quantum computers to realise their full potential. ⚡ While the field has seen promising progress with demonstrations of early QEC experiments, scalable, real-time quantum error decoding must be implemented on hardware to overcome the critical ‘backlog’ problem. The backlog problem occurs when qubit errors aren’t detected fast enough and build up in a quantum computer, slowing down and eventually stopping the computation. 💥     In a new experiment, the Riverlane team demonstrated that our quantum error decoder - the heart of our core product, the ‘QEC Stack’ - can avoid the backlog problem even on superconducting hardware with the strictest speed requirements.    By integrating a scalable FPGA decoder with the control system of Rigetti’s Computing’s superconducting quantum processor, we observed the following: • An 8-qubit stability experiment with up to 25 decoding rounds and a mean decoding time per round of less than 1 microsecond.  • Logical error suppression as the number of decoding rounds increased.  • A decoding response time of just 9.6 microseconds for nine measurement rounds. In other words, the world’s first low-latency QEC experiment! 🥇   💡 This experiment paves the way for more than just keeping logical qubits alive—it sets the stage for complex operations like lattice surgery and magic state teleportation, both crucial for building fault-tolerant, useful quantum computers. 🔗 Read more about this experiment on arXiv here: https://lnkd.in/eWKz_QVp
